Gather Your Ingredients & Tools

| Ingredient | Quantity |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Olives | 1 cup | Chopped green and black olives for a savory olive dip. |
| Cream Cheese | 8 oz | Base for the dip, adds creaminess to the cocktail inspired dip. |
| Blue Cheese | 1/2 cup | For a rich flavor reminiscent of a blue cheese olive dip. |
| Sour Cream | 1/2 cup | Enhances the dip’s texture, perfect for a party appetizer martini dip. |
| Lemon Juice | 1 tbsp | Adds brightness to the martini dip recipe. |
| Fresh Herbs | 2 tbsp | Chopped parsley or chives for garnish, complements the gin inspired dip recipe. |

How to Make Dirty Martini Dip with Blue Cheese Olives Step by Step

- In a mixing bowl, combine 8 ounces of cream cheese, softened to room temperature.
- Add 1/2 cup of sour cream to the bowl and mix until smooth.
- Stir in 1/4 cup of mayonnaise for added creaminess.
- Add 2 tablespoons of dry vermouth for that signature martini flavor.
- Incorporate 1 tablespoon of olive brine for extra tang.
- Chop 1/2 cup of blue cheese olives and fold them into the mixture.
- Season with black pepper and a pinch of salt to taste.
- Transfer the dip to a serving bowl and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to let the flavors meld.
- Serve with pita chips, crackers, or fresh veggies for dipping.
